About this format

TAR.XZ format context

Format: TAR.XZ

Overview

tar.xz became important when software distributors wanted smaller release artifacts while keeping the familiar tar-based packaging model.

Release engineering wanted better compression than older defaults without abandoning tar's directory-preserving archive behavior.

tar.

TAR.XZ is closely associated with tar + xz Unix ecosystem.

TAR.XZ is usually selected for workflows that center on download packaging, backup exchange, cross-platform sharing.

Strengths

  • Strong compression for release archives.
  • Familiar in Unix and Linux distribution contexts.
  • Keeps tar-based packaging semantics.

Limitations

  • More CPU-heavy than lighter compression choices.
  • Less friendly for casual non-technical sharing than ZIP.

Interesting Context

Many Linux and source-distribution workflows adopted tar.xz as a practical successor to older tar.gz and tar.bz2 release habits.

tar.xz is widespread in Linux distributions, open-source release engineering, embedded firmware, and command-line packaging workflows.

Developers, maintainers, and infrastructure teams use it when shipping technical artifacts to recipients who are comfortable with standard Unix archive tools.

Its ecosystem is modern, technical, and strongly tied to Unix-style release practices.

How TAR.XZ fits into workflows

Workflow role: TAR.XZ

Convert to tar.xz when you need a compact Unix-friendly archive for source releases, firmware packages, research data, or server-side bundles where the recipients are expected to use technical tooling.

It is the right target when smaller archive size is worth slower compression.

Choose it over tar.gz for distribution efficiency, and over plain xz when you need to preserve a full directory tree.
